Mistblade Shinobi bounces an opponent's creature every time it connects — repeatable, free tempo that costs nothing beyond the ninjutsu trigger. In Yuriko, the Tiger's Shadow lists it sees nearly 79% inclusion because the payoff compounds immediately, and Thousand-Faced Shadow exists specifically to feed setups like this one.

Yuriko, the Tiger's Shadow
Mistblade Shinobi appears in 79% of Yuriko, the Tiger's Shadow decks because bouncing a blocker clears the path for repeated ninjutsu triggers, which is the exact engine Yuriko needs to drain the table.

Splinter, Radical Rat
Splinter, Radical Rat rewards unblocked creatures with extra value, so Mistblade Shinobi does double duty — clearing a blocker on the way in and then generating Splinter's trigger on a clean hit.

Goro-Goro and Satoru
Goro-Goro and Satoru wants creatures connecting, and Mistblade Shinobi's bounce effect removes the blocker that would otherwise shut that plan down.

Jin Sakai, Ghost of Tsushima
Jin Sakai, Ghost of Tsushima punishes opponents for losing creatures to combat or effects, so Mistblade Shinobi's bounce feeds that pattern every time it ninjutsus in.

Satoru, the Infiltrator
Satoru, the Infiltrator draws cards whenever a creature connects unblocked, and Mistblade Shinobi keeps that path open by bouncing whatever stood in the way.

Mistblade Shinobi is legal in Commander, Legacy, Modern, Pauper, Vintage, and Oathbreaker, but it almost exclusively sees play in Commander. In Pauper it's technically usable, but a one-power common that requires a combat step to do anything is too slow for that format's aggressive and tempo-focused threats. Legacy and Vintage have access to ninjutsu synergies but rarely build around them given the raw power of everything else available. Commander is where Mistblade Shinobi thrives — repeated bounces in a multiplayer game compound quickly, and the low ninjutsu cost means almost any unblocked creature becomes a setup.
